python连接数据库

import mysql

打开数据库连接(用户名,密码,数据库名)

db = mysql.connect(host="localhost",user="用户名",
passwd="密码",db="表名",port=3306)

使用cursor()方法获取游标操作

cursor = db.cursor()

使用execute()执行sql语句操作

cursor. execute("sql语句")

使用fetchone()方法获得一条数据

data = cursor.fetchone()
print data
db.close() #关闭数据库连接

/获取结果/
cursor.fetchone()查询一条
cursor.fetchmany(3)查询前3条
cursor.fetchall()查询所有

游标的概念与作用:
游标实际上是一种能从包括多条数据记录的结果集中每次提取一条记录的机制。游标充当指针的作用,尽管游标能遍历结果中的所有行,但它一次只指向一行
sql的游标是一种临时的数据库对象,即可以用来存放在数据库表中的数据行副本,也可以指向存储在数据库中的数据行的指针,游标提供了在逐行的基础上操作表中数据的方法
游标的一个常见用途就是保存查询结果,以便日后使用。

你可能感兴趣的:(python连接数据库)